Summary
Analyses of the performances of selected environmentally-friendly fluids in theoretical heat pump cycles with moderate/high condensing temperatures were carried out, and HFC-254cb, HC-600, HC-600a, HFC-143, HFE-134 and hydrocarbon/fire-suppressant blends proved to be promising working fluids.
